The Role of Artificial Intelligence in Autonomous Vehicle Navigation

Autonomous vehicle navigation relies on a combination of sensors, cameras, and mapping data to detect and interpret the vehicle’s surroundings. GPS technology plays a crucial role in providing real-time location data, allowing the vehicle to determine its position on the road accurately. This continuous stream of information enables the autonomous vehicle to make decisions in real-time, such as steering, changing lanes, and adjusting speed to navigate safely.

One key aspect of autonomous vehicle navigation is the use of complex algorithms that process the data collected from sensors to generate a detailed understanding of the vehicle’s environment. These algorithms analyze the information received from cameras, lidar sensors, radar, and ultrasonic sensors to identify obstacles, traffic signs, lane markings, and other critical elements on the road. By continuously updating this data and combining it with high-definition maps, autonomous vehicles can navigate challenging scenarios and adapt to changing road conditions effectively.

The Importance of Sensor Technology in Autonomous Vehicles

Sensor technology is a crucial component in the functionality of autonomous vehicles. These advanced vehicles rely on a network of sensors, such as LiDAR, radar, cameras, and ultrasonic sensors, to perceive the surrounding environment accurately. By collecting and interpreting data in real-time, sensors enable autonomous vehicles to navigate safely and make informed decisions on the road.

The integration of sensor technology in autonomous vehicles facilitates tasks like detecting obstacles, identifying road signs, and recognizing pedestrians. This real-time data processing is fundamental in ensuring the vehicle’s responsiveness to its surroundings and enhances the overall safety of the driving experience. As sensor technology continues to evolve, it plays a pivotal role in advancing the capabilities of autonomous vehicles towards achieving full autonomy on the roads.
